Hidden Costs Of Flying, Airbnbs, Hotels & More
When booking a hotel in Las Vegas, did you know there could be a resort fee that could cost you hundreds of extra dollars? Did you know that a lot of airlines now charge you for all of your checked luggage including your first bag? Join us as we do a deep dive into hidden and not so hidden fees! We talk about hotels, Airbnb, airlines and even entry or exit fees from countries – we want you to be prepared! Having to pay a fee is one thing but not expecting it when you have budgeted for it is terrible so let us help you plan!

Staying Hydrated While Traveling, Safely
Water is vital to life and it is vital to stay hydrated especially while travelling and out of your element! Your level of concern drinking water safety will depend on where you go! On this episode Meggan gives some tips on how to prepare to consume water when doing resort travel – those ice cubes can get you if you aren’t safe! What should you do to prepare and some tips to avoid getting sick while travelling! Always ask, no matter where you travel, at your accommodation (hotel or inn) if the water is safe to drink because if so, that’s great plus it would be free! Drink and hydrate…
